What this record shows

This record is dominated by food and beverage: $5,324 of the $6,754 with a category attached, or 78.8%. It is spread thinly across 27 manufacturers, the largest accounting for just 18.5% — the pattern of someone who eats at a lot of different presentations. 2025 is the largest year on record at $2,014, more than ten times the $84 reported in 2019. Among physician assistant clinicians in NM with any reported payments, this total sits in the top 5% — high for the specialty, which is a reason to read the composition above rather than the number alone.

What this is not: this is the amount Original Medicare Part B allowed for services this provider billed in 2024. It is not their income. It excludes Medicare Advantage — now more than half of all Medicare enrollment — along with Medicaid and all commercial insurance, and it is gross practice revenue before staff, rent, supplies and malpractice premiums. CMS also suppresses any figure covering ten or fewer patients, so low-volume providers appear smaller than they are.
